小编Ben*_*ebe的帖子

在SQLiteDatabase.query()中使用String [] selectionArgs

如何使用String[] selectionArgsSQLiteDatabase.query()?我希望我可以把它设置为null,因为我没有用它.我只是尝试将数据库中的整个未排序表加载到Cursor.有关如何实现这一目标的任何建议?

android android-cursor android-sqlite

49
推荐指数
2
解决办法
4万
查看次数

当ISR运行并发生另一个中断时会发生什么?

如果ISR正在运行,会发生另一个中断,会发生什么?第一个中断是否被中断?第二个中断会被忽略吗?或者在第一次ISR完成后会发射吗?

编辑 我忘了将它包含在问题中(但我将其包含在标签中),我想问一下这是如何在Atmel AVR上运行的.

embedded avr interrupt

19
推荐指数
2
解决办法
3万
查看次数

将gzip文件解压缩到特定目录

什么是以下命令的gzip等价物:

tar xvzf /usr/local/file/file/file.tar.gz -C /usr/local/extract_here
Run Code Online (Sandbox Code Playgroud)

我在尝试

gzip -d /usr/local/file/file/file.tar.gz -C /usr/local/extract_here
Run Code Online (Sandbox Code Playgroud)

但它不起作用,我怎么用gzip做到这一点?

compression gzip

17
推荐指数
3
解决办法
8万
查看次数

在ISR中过早"返回"会发生什么?

我正在使用AVR-GCC 4.9.2,我想知道如果我在AVR的ISR中过早返回会发生什么?

ISR(USART_RXC_vect)
{
    ...
    if(idx == BUFSIZE)
        return;
    ...
 }
Run Code Online (Sandbox Code Playgroud)

return被翻译成reti指令吗?或者我需要reti()自己加入?

我正在寻找幕后发生的事情的详细解释.

embedded avr isr

10
推荐指数
1
解决办法
860
查看次数

ruby数组将第一个,第二个放入变量,其余放入另一个变量

我想将一个数组拆分为三个变量; 将第一个值转换为一个变量,将第二个值转换为另一个变量,将所有其余值转换为一个字符串,例如:

arr = ["a1","b2","c3","d4","e5","f6"]
var1 = arr[0] # var1 => "a1"
var2 = arr[1] # var2 => "b2"
var3 = ? # var3 should be => "c3d4e5f6"
Run Code Online (Sandbox Code Playgroud)

为每个变量实现列出的值需要什么代码?

ruby arrays variables

9
推荐指数
2
解决办法
7924
查看次数

Textarea自动滚动到底部

我有一个textarea,我附加数据textarea.value += "more text\n";,我希望它"保持"滚动到底部,所以它将始终显示最后一行.

我读过我应该这样做:

var textarea = document.getElementById('textarea_id');
textarea.scrollTop = textarea.scrollHeight;
Run Code Online (Sandbox Code Playgroud)

但我试过(http://jsfiddle.net/BenjiWiebe/mya0u1zo/)我无法让它工作.

我究竟做错了什么?

javascript

8
推荐指数
1
解决办法
2万
查看次数

如何在完成后停止CSS3动画跳回到开头

我有一个CSS3动画,简单地移动的<div>下降(通过top: 0px;top: 300px;).但我的问题是,我不知道如何阻止<div>动画结束时返回顶部.有没有办法阻止这种情况?

这是一个小提琴样本:http://jsfiddle.net/y8tJ7/

css3 css-animations

7
推荐指数
1
解决办法
4678
查看次数

已安装RPM Spec文件但%doc指令中的未打包文件

我正在尝试创建一个.spec文件,并将%log,README,INSTALL,COPYING,NEWS,AUTHORS放在%file指令右下方的%doc指令中.包tarname是recafoh-prealpha,版本是svn73.rpmbuild -ba recafoh.spec说

RPM build errors:
    Installed (but unpackaged) file(s) found:
   /usr/share/doc/recafoh-prealpha/COPYING
   /usr/share/doc/recafoh-prealpha/ChangeLog
   /usr/share/doc/recafoh-prealpha/INSTALL
   /usr/share/doc/recafoh-prealpha/NEWS
   /usr/share/doc/recafoh-prealpha/README
   /usr/share/doc/recafoh-prealpha/TODO
Run Code Online (Sandbox Code Playgroud)

但它们安装在BUILDROOT/usr/share/doc/recafoh-prealpha-svn73/{ChangeLog,README,INSTALL,COPYING,NEWS,AUTHORS}中,这是另一件奇怪的事情:README也安装在BUILDROOT/usr/share/DOC/recafoh-prealpha-svn73.

那么,任何人都可以解释1)如何解决rpmbuild错误,2)为什么README安装在recafoh-prealpha-svn73和README中,其余的安装在recafoh-prealpha?

非常感谢

编辑:

以下是recafoh.spec文件的相关部分:

%files
%doc AUTHORS ChangeLog COPYING NEWS README TODO
%{_sbindir}/recafohd
%{_bindir}/recafoh
Run Code Online (Sandbox Code Playgroud)

specifications rpm

1
推荐指数
1
解决办法
3167
查看次数